What is the California Birth Record Application?
The California Birth Record Application is a formal request used to obtain certified copies of birth records from the California Department of Public Health. This application serves as a vital tool for individuals seeking official documentation for identification purposes, legal matters, or citizenship verification. It is crucial to understand the difference between certified copies and certified informational copies; the former is valid for official use while the latter is marked as not valid for identity establishment.

Who is eligible to apply for a certified copy of a birth record?
Eligibility typically includes parents of the registrant, legal guardians, or individuals who can demonstrate a tangible interest in the document, such as through a notarized request.
What supporting documents are required to complete the application?
Along with the completed application form, you may need to provide a valid photo ID, proof of your relationship to the registrant, and payment for any fees related to the request.
How long does processing take for a birth record application?
Processing times can vary; however, you should expect to wait anywhere from two to six weeks depending on the volume of requests received by the California Department of Public Health.
